Client Background

Client: A leading tech firm in the USA

Industry Type:  IT

Services: SaaS, Products

Organization Size: 100+

The Problem

API Integration to read/write data in SQL tables from an online application.

Our Solution

To write the api between qualtrics and sql server using python programming language.

Solution Architecture

C:\Users\kambl\Downloads\Quatrics Integration.jpg

Fig. System Architecture

Deliverables

Python Software

Documentation

Tools used

Python
Qualtrics

Models used

Pandas
Requests
numpy
Zipfile
io
pyodbc

Skills used

Extract Transfer Load

Databases used

SQL Server

What are the technical Challenges Faced during Project Execution

During the project execution, we faced the following challenges:

  1. After data integration, the content of the file was not readable.
  2. Mapping the values with the required columns.

How the Technical Challenges were Solved

To solve the technical challenges, we provided the following solutions as follow:

  1. To get the content into the CSV format after integration we used the Io module to get the text content.
  2. To get the mapping values we created the CSV file and store the record in it and fetch that record to the SQl.

Business Impact

Using this script the client can now fetch the Qualtrics data into the SQL server automatically after every 1 hour.

Project Snapshots 

Fig. Data in CSV Format


Fig. Data in Table form

Fig. SQL data

Project website url

Github:  https://github.com/AjayBidyarthy/Richi-S-api

Project Video

Contact Details

Here are my contact details:

Email: ajay@blackcoffer.com

Skype: asbidyarthy

WhatsApp: +91 9717367468

Telegram: @asbidyarthy 

For project discussions and daily updates, would you like to use Slack, Skype, Telegram, or Whatsapp? Please recommend, what would work best for you.